Urate Crystals in a Baby

WebNov 29, 2024 · Stool is usually brown due to the interaction of bile with enzymes present in the stool. Bile is a liquid secreted by your liver to aid digestion of food. If you pass orange … WebApr 17, 2024 · Red- or maroon-colored stool that contains blood is called hematochezia . The brighter color is because the blood is coming from lower in the digestive tract, like the colon or the rectum. Red blood in the stool can have a number of medical causes. 5 Always see a doctor if you find blood in your stool. Hemorrhoids
